A poet is a man who puts up a ladder to a star and climbs it while playing a violin.
- Edmond De Goncourt
When did I realise I was God? Well, I was praying and I suddenly realised I was talking to myself.
- Peter O’toole
The truth is a snare: you cannot have it, without being caught. You cannot have the truth in such a way that you catch it, but only in such a way that it catches you.
- Søren Kierkegaard

The reason people find it so hard to be happy is that they always see the past better than it was, the present worse than it is, and the future less resolved than it will be
- Marcel Pagnol
Let us not pray to be sheltered from dangers but to be fearless when facing them.
- Rabindranath Tagore
